Finding light for None in your home
Passiflora colinvauxii love being close to bright, sunny windows 😎.
Place it less than 1ft from a south-facing window to maximize the potential for growth.
Passiflora colinvauxii does not tolerate low-light 🚫.

How to fertilize Passiflora colinvauxii
Most potting soils come with ample nutrients which plants use to produce new growth.
By the time your plant has depleted the nutrients in its soil it’s likely grown enough to need a larger pot anyway.
To replenish this plant's nutrients, repot your Passiflora colinvauxii after it doubles in size or once a year—whichever comes first.
